Fix MR Selection, Go Code Refactor (#358)

refactor: Refactors the Go codebase into a more modular and idiomatic approach
fix: require selection of specific MR when there are multiple targets for a given source branch
feat: Allows for the passing of Gitlab's filter options when choosing an MR, improves MR selection
feat: API to choose an MR from a list based on the provided username's involvement as an assignee/reviewer/author

This is a #MINOR release

cmd/app/draft_notes_test.go Normal file
View File

@@ -0,0 +1,153 @@
package app
import (
"net/http"
"testing"
"github.com/xanzy/go-gitlab"
)
type fakeDraftNoteManager struct {
testBase
}
func (f fakeDraftNoteManager) ListDraftNotes(pid interface{}, mergeRequest int, opt *gitlab.ListDraftNotesOptions, options ...gitlab.RequestOptionFunc) ([]*gitlab.DraftNote, *gitlab.Response, error) {
resp, err := f.handleGitlabError()
if err != nil {
return nil, nil, err
}
return []*gitlab.DraftNote{}, resp, err
}
func (f fakeDraftNoteManager) CreateDraftNote(pid interface{}, mergeRequest int, opt *gitlab.CreateDraftNoteOptions, options ...gitlab.RequestOptionFunc) (*gitlab.DraftNote, *gitlab.Response, error) {
resp, err := f.handleGitlabError()
if err != nil {
return nil, nil, err
}
return &gitlab.DraftNote{}, resp, err
}
func (f fakeDraftNoteManager) DeleteDraftNote(pid interface{}, mergeRequest int, note int, options ...gitlab.RequestOptionFunc) (*gitlab.Response, error) {
return f.handleGitlabError()
}
func (f fakeDraftNoteManager) UpdateDraftNote(pid interface{}, mergeRequest int, note int, opt *gitlab.UpdateDraftNoteOptions, options ...gitlab.RequestOptionFunc) (*gitlab.DraftNote, *gitlab.Response, error) {
resp, err := f.handleGitlabError()
if err != nil {
return nil, nil, err
}
return &gitlab.DraftNote{}, resp, err
}
func TestListDraftNotes(t *testing.T) {
t.Run("Lists all draft notes", func(t *testing.T) {
request := makeRequest(t, http.MethodGet, "/mr/draft_notes/", nil)
svc := draftNoteService{testProjectData, fakeDraftNoteManager{}}
data := getSuccessData(t, svc, request)
assert(t, data.Status, http.StatusOK)
assert(t, data.Message, "Draft notes fetched successfully")
})
t.Run("Handles error from Gitlab client", func(t *testing.T) {
request := makeRequest(t, http.MethodGet, "/mr/draft_notes/", nil)
svc := draftNoteService{testProjectData, fakeDraftNoteManager{testBase{errFromGitlab: true}}}
data := getFailData(t, svc, request)
checkErrorFromGitlab(t, data, "Could not get draft notes")
})
t.Run("Handles non-200s from Gitlab client", func(t *testing.T) {
request := makeRequest(t, http.MethodGet, "/mr/draft_notes/", nil)
svc := draftNoteService{testProjectData, fakeDraftNoteManager{testBase{status: http.StatusSeeOther}}}
data := getFailData(t, svc, request)
checkNon200(t, data, "Could not get draft notes", "/mr/draft_notes/")
})
}
func TestPostDraftNote(t *testing.T) {
var testPostDraftNoteRequestData = PostDraftNoteRequest{Comment: "Some comment"}
t.Run("Posts new draft note", func(t *testing.T) {
request := makeRequest(t, http.MethodPost, "/mr/draft_notes/", testPostDraftNoteRequestData)
svc := draftNoteService{testProjectData, fakeDraftNoteManager{}}
data := getSuccessData(t, svc, request)
assert(t, data.Status, http.StatusOK)
assert(t, data.Message, "Draft note created successfully")
})
t.Run("Handles error from Gitlab client", func(t *testing.T) {
request := makeRequest(t, http.MethodPost, "/mr/draft_notes/", testPostDraftNoteRequestData)
svc := draftNoteService{testProjectData, fakeDraftNoteManager{testBase{errFromGitlab: true}}}
data := getFailData(t, svc, request)
checkErrorFromGitlab(t, data, "Could not create draft note")
})
t.Run("Handles non-200s from Gitlab client", func(t *testing.T) {
request := makeRequest(t, http.MethodPost, "/mr/draft_notes/", testPostDraftNoteRequestData)
svc := draftNoteService{testProjectData, fakeDraftNoteManager{testBase{status: http.StatusSeeOther}}}
data := getFailData(t, svc, request)
checkNon200(t, data, "Could not create draft note", "/mr/draft_notes/")
})
}
func TestDeleteDraftNote(t *testing.T) {
t.Run("Deletes new draft note", func(t *testing.T) {
request := makeRequest(t, http.MethodDelete, "/mr/draft_notes/3", nil)
svc := draftNoteService{testProjectData, fakeDraftNoteManager{}}
data := getSuccessData(t, svc, request)
assert(t, data.Status, http.StatusOK)
assert(t, data.Message, "Draft note deleted")
})
t.Run("Handles error from Gitlab client", func(t *testing.T) {
request := makeRequest(t, http.MethodDelete, "/mr/draft_notes/3", nil)
svc := draftNoteService{testProjectData, fakeDraftNoteManager{testBase{errFromGitlab: true}}}
data := getFailData(t, svc, request)
checkErrorFromGitlab(t, data, "Could not delete draft note")
})
t.Run("Handles non-200s from Gitlab client", func(t *testing.T) {
request := makeRequest(t, http.MethodDelete, "/mr/draft_notes/3", nil)
svc := draftNoteService{testProjectData, fakeDraftNoteManager{testBase{status: http.StatusSeeOther}}}
data := getFailData(t, svc, request)
checkNon200(t, data, "Could not delete draft note", "/mr/draft_notes/3")
})
t.Run("Handles bad ID", func(t *testing.T) {
request := makeRequest(t, http.MethodDelete, "/mr/draft_notes/blah", nil)
svc := draftNoteService{testProjectData, fakeDraftNoteManager{testBase{status: http.StatusSeeOther}}}
data := getFailData(t, svc, request)
assert(t, data.Message, "Could not parse draft note ID")
assert(t, data.Status, http.StatusBadRequest)
})
}
func TestEditDraftNote(t *testing.T) {
var testUpdateDraftNoteRequest = UpdateDraftNoteRequest{Note: "Some new note"}
t.Run("Edits new draft note", func(t *testing.T) {
request := makeRequest(t, http.MethodPatch, "/mr/draft_notes/3", testUpdateDraftNoteRequest)
svc := draftNoteService{testProjectData, fakeDraftNoteManager{}}
data := getSuccessData(t, svc, request)
assert(t, data.Status, http.StatusOK)
assert(t, data.Message, "Draft note updated")
})
t.Run("Handles error from Gitlab client", func(t *testing.T) {
request := makeRequest(t, http.MethodPatch, "/mr/draft_notes/3", testUpdateDraftNoteRequest)
svc := draftNoteService{testProjectData, fakeDraftNoteManager{testBase{errFromGitlab: true}}}
data := getFailData(t, svc, request)
checkErrorFromGitlab(t, data, "Could not update draft note")
})
t.Run("Handles non-200s from Gitlab client", func(t *testing.T) {
request := makeRequest(t, http.MethodPatch, "/mr/draft_notes/3", testUpdateDraftNoteRequest)
svc := draftNoteService{testProjectData, fakeDraftNoteManager{testBase{status: http.StatusSeeOther}}}
data := getFailData(t, svc, request)
checkNon200(t, data, "Could not update draft note", "/mr/draft_notes/3")
})
t.Run("Handles bad ID", func(t *testing.T) {
request := makeRequest(t, http.MethodPatch, "/mr/draft_notes/blah", testUpdateDraftNoteRequest)
svc := draftNoteService{testProjectData, fakeDraftNoteManager{testBase{status: http.StatusSeeOther}}}
data := getFailData(t, svc, request)
assert(t, data.Message, "Could not parse draft note ID")
assert(t, data.Status, http.StatusBadRequest)
})
t.Run("Handles empty note", func(t *testing.T) {
requestData := testUpdateDraftNoteRequest
requestData.Note = ""
request := makeRequest(t, http.MethodPatch, "/mr/draft_notes/3", requestData)
svc := draftNoteService{testProjectData, fakeDraftNoteManager{testBase{status: http.StatusSeeOther}}}
data := getFailData(t, svc, request)
assert(t, data.Message, "Must provide draft note text")
assert(t, data.Status, http.StatusBadRequest)
})
}
